Transaction 97530af4b64546ad1f91f0fffe8b07ac7cb0c6fc0fa4a8a3440b746dd8c89dea

68 Input
2 Outputs
  • 97530af4b64546ad1f91f0fffe8b07ac7cb0c6fc0fa4a8a3440b746dd8c89dea:0
  • value  1281831045
    address  37wj6WaL77dwhnhyQipyLWg92JDzN2YzGn
  • 97530af4b64546ad1f91f0fffe8b07ac7cb0c6fc0fa4a8a3440b746dd8c89dea:1
  • value  889106
    address  35hSd7uzBLquuqDrZrKCwbzxCvRdL5PLh9